Output e3cb707bc86f73014a58612ac6d75ffd76bf69cc63c150a4618fee634ad0fb18:0

value
3634820
script pubkey
OP_0 OP_PUSHBYTES_32 bbf22af5113fc1bdcde271d0016ccd5858d5e0587832e9130149d23e7f05aa0b
address
bc1qh0ez4ag38lqmmn0zw8gqzmxdtpvdtczc0qewjycpf8frulc94g9sjzugfm
transaction
e3cb707bc86f73014a58612ac6d75ffd76bf69cc63c150a4618fee634ad0fb18